Grid Slot Basics
Cluster grid slots pay when matching symbols touch each other. Connections usually count vertically and horizontally across the grid. Diagonal links are uncommon but exist in a few builds. Each game defines a minimum number of symbols needed to form a paying group. Smaller groups return lower values, while larger clusters pay more. Once a cluster pays, it is removed from the board. Remaining symbols fall into empty spaces through gravity. New symbols then drop from the top to rebuild the grid. This process can repeat many times during one spin. Grid size directly affects how often refills appear. Larger grids often create more frequent board changes.

Cluster Win Logic
Every cluster slot counts connected symbols to calculate a result. The game checks the grid after each drop for new valid groups. When another cluster forms, the game clears it again. This creates a chain of drops within the same paid spin. Some titles increase a multiplier with each successful clear. Others apply fixed boosters tied to specific symbols. Multipliers may reset after the chain ends or stay until the next spin. Long chains can stretch a single spin over several seconds. This structure makes timing and pacing different from line-based slots. Knowing when multipliers reset helps manage expectations. Clear on-screen counters make tracking easier.

New Grid Trends
Recent cluster releases focus on extending drop chains. Step-based multipliers are now more common. Some games add special tiles that trigger respins. Collection meters may unlock extra rows over time. Multiple RTP editions are now standard for many titles. Visual clarity has improved to support fast symbol motion. Some modifiers change symbol values mid-round. Others alter grid shape during bonus features. Small boosters are used to reduce long inactive periods. Reading the rules screen matters more than ever.
